My sister Nisha and I were honored to be invited to the prestigious Nick Buoniconti Great Sports Legends Dinner that took place at the extravagant Waldorf Astoria in NYC.
“The annual event benefits The Buoniconti Fund to Cure Paralysis and raises funds to support the cutting-edge spinal cord injury research done by researchers at the University of Miami Miller School of Medicine’s Miami Project to Cure Paralysis. Since its inception in 1985, the Great Sports Legends Dinner has honored nearly 300 sports legends and honorees and has raised millions for The Miami Project’s spinal cord injury research programs.”
The Dinner opened with the National Anthem. The event was gracefully hosted by Bob Costas. Bob introduced the great sports legends and guests listened to several charming speeches from James Worthy, Dave Winfield, Nick Faldo, Terry Bradshaw, Shawn Johnson, Gary Stevens, Antron, Brown, Kenny Smith and Jim Kelly.
